1.City Palace
Constructed in 1559 by Maharana Udai Mirza Singh, City Palace is the crowning jewel of Udaipur and a must to visit when planning your trip to Udaipur. Situated on the banks of Pichola Lake, the architecture of this palace boasts an amalgamation of European, Medieval and Chinese styles of architecture. It’s home to 11 majestic palaces that have a vast and colourful history as they were built through different eras of rulers and times. If the sheer size of the palace doesn’t stun you, the courtyards, terraces, pavilions and hanging gardens surely will. You can of course take a tour of the palace, visit the City Palace Museum and enjoy the rustic and scenic beauty of the surrounding lake Pichola.
2.Lake Palace
A famous treasure and pride to the city of Udaipur, Lake Palace is one of the most popular wedding destinations in the country as well as internationally. Also known as Jag Niwas, the palace has actually built on an island in Lake Pichola in the year 1746 by Maharana Jagat Singh II. In the 1960s, it was converted into a luxury hotel of the Taj chain. You can find many sources of entertainment at this palace, such as dining like royalty at any of their restaurants, boating in Lake Pichola, a historic and rich heritage tour and last but not the last, enjoy a peaceful and gorgeous sunset at the nearby Lake Fatehsagar.
3.Bagore Ki Haveli
An 18th-century marvel, this Haveli was built by Amir Chand Bawa, who was the then Chief Minister at the Royal Court of Mewar. It gets its name from Maharana Shakti Singh of Bagore in 1878 when he took up residence at the Haveli. Further converted into a museum, the Haveli represents the royalty and culture of Mewar with collections including jewellery boxes, copper vessels and so on. With over 100 rooms, they also present musical shows in the evenings. The museum is a famous attraction of Udaipur and you can witness the shows in the evenings as well as a theatre show on the ground. Children can enjoy the puppetry show of folk tales as the adults engage in the shopping for handicrafts, souvenirs and other artworks.

Sightseeing in the Pink City: The Best Attractions to Make Your Trip Fun & Memorable
Jaipur, also known as the ‘Pink City’ because of the colour of the stone used largely in the city, is famous for its bazaars which sell embroidered leather shoes, blue pottery and tie and dye scarves. It is a culturally diverse city, with its streets often filled with people belonging to different communities and tribes, dressed in their traditional costumes and the many famous forts, especially the Amber fort-palace. A significant part of Western Rajasthan, this city itself forms the heart of the Thar Desert which has in turn been a strong force in shaping the history, lifestyles and architecture of this quaint location.
That being said, it is a dream destination for those craving a taste of articulate craftsmanship of the local artisans and the extravagant beauty of the forts and palaces that make up this city. From all the plethora of attractions available, how do you choose where to sightsee? Given below are a list of the top three such attractions that are a must-visit and will simply dazzle you away with their charm. So, let’s dive straight in!
1.Amber Fort
Located 11 kilometres from Jaipur and also called Amer Fort, this Fort was built by Raja Mansingh in 1592. Constructed with red sandstone and marble stone, this fort is one of the most scenic blends of Hindu-Muslim architecture. With an overall of four entrances to the fort, the fort also boats four marvellous courtyards. One of them, known as the Diwan-I-Aam can be accessed by the public and is a pleasantry to your eyes. You can engage in activities of the fort, such as elephant riding, partake in the light and sound show in the evening and relish some of the most mouth-watering cuisines at 1135 AD. Those looking for slightly more religious attractions can also visit the temple of Sila Devi.
2. Hawal Mahal
If you’re planning a trip to Jaipur, you simply can’t miss the Hawa Mahal. A representation of beautiful and rich architectural expertise, this Mahal was constructed by Maharaja Sawai Pratab Singh in 1799. With 953 windows in the palace to provide ventilation, this palace is also called the ‘Palace of Winds’. According to folklore, the Mahal was constructed to allow the Royal women of the Rajput family to have a closer connection to the city and the five-story building doesn’t have a staircase to reach the upper floors. Located in the Pink City Bazar, you can visit the archaeological museum of the palace and even have some sight-seeing fun by indulging your shopaholic instincts at the Bazaar!
3. Jal Mahal
Jal Mahal is another pride of the Pink City and an architectural delight. Located right at the centre of Mansagar Lake, it was built in the 18th century by Maharaja Jai Singh II. The hallways are rich in an opulent atmosphere as you pass through them and the Chameli Bagh is fragrant and a pleasure to your senses. The Mahal also attracts some of nature’s best, with migratory birds such as the grey heron, White-browed Wagtail and blue-tailed bee-eaters using it as a visiting site. Maharaja Jai Singh ii built this palace as a hunting lodge and summer retreat and apart from seasonal birdwatching, the Mahal also offers many attractions such as camel rides and shopping for textiles and carpets.

- Gateway of India
Standing tall on the banks of the Arabian Sea at the Apollo bunder waterfront area, this monument is one of Mumbai’s most prized possessions. The basalt archway is 26-meters long and a blend of Roman arches and traditional Hindu-Muslim architecture. It was built as a welcome gesture to King George V and Queen Mary when they visited British India in 1911. Today, it is one of the most famous gathering spots to watch yachts and ferries take off to sea. A bustling source of street-food, indulge in the famous bhelpuri from street food vendors and take a walk in the Colaba Causeway Market.
-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j Vastu Museum
One of the things on the priority list when visiting Mumbai, this museum was earlier known as the Prince of Wales Museum of Western India. It is an important historic attraction and taking its tour will take you almost the entire day. With an expansive permanent collection of 70,000 items which include Indian miniature paintings, Himalayan art, antique Asian coins, jewelled swords etc., the museum is a marvel to Mumbai’s growing list of tourist attractions. The surrounding area of the museum also poses as architectural delights of the Gothic style.
- Marine Drive
Can a trip to Mumbai ever be complete without watching the sunset from Marine Drive? A 3.6-kilometre-long, C-shaped boulevard, it offers some of the most serene views of the coast. Not just that, the street is also lined with gorgeous Art Deco Buildings which have recently earned their place as a UNESCO World Heritage site. Also known as ‘Queen’s Necklace’, the drive resembles a pearl necklace from above due to the street lights painted against an after sunset sky.
